How Does the NRC Ensure Compliance?

The NRC ensures compliance through a combination of licensing, inspection, and enforcement actions. Medical facilities that use radioactive materials must obtain a license from the NRC, which involves a thorough review of their safety protocols and capabilities. Once licensed, these facilities are subject to regular inspections to ensure they adhere to NRC regulations. In cases of non-compliance, the NRC has the authority to impose fines, suspend licenses, or take other enforcement actions to protect public health and safety.
